JOHNNY NEIL BUILDERS 1200m

Track: GOOD 4     True  

There looks to be decent speed in this 1200m field from barrier rise. GIRLS LIGHT UP (11) she is much better than last start showed. The mare can handle it dry or wet so she is each-way no matter the footing on offer today. OUR SASSIE ANNE (8) won her Maiden here. She has been very consistent in her last five runs. Loves the wet tracks. Include in all of your multiples. ROCKIN ROSIE (5) was a game second fresh up. Win chance here no matter the footing on offer. CITY GIRL (9) is fresh up here. Won her Maiden in this state. Each-way chance here for sure and the tote will be very telling. LEINSTER (3) won her Maiden fresh up comfortably. Class riser. Looks sure to handle this grade as well. Well drawn. SUGGESTED PLAY: Girls Light Up and City Girl are win wagers.
